CryptoLocker is ransomware that encrypts files on Windows computers and then requests payment to decrypt them. To put it into simpler terms, picture this: You have hundreds of family photos and important financial documents … See more As of 2014, the U.S. Department of Justice announced that CryptoLocker is effectively nonfunctionaland is unable to encrypt devices. Despite this, other variations of CryptoLocker and similar ransomware … See more After CryptoLocker surfaced in 2013, law enforcement agencies from all over the globe collaborated to put a stop to it. This mission was known as Operation Tovar. In 2014, the Department … See more Some sourcesindicate that CryptoLocker garnered around $3 million from victims of the ransomware attack.
